<feed xmlns='http://www.w3.org/2005/Atom'>
<title>gocryptfs/internal/readpassword/passfile_test.go, branch xattr_user_buffer</title>
<subtitle>Mirror of gocryptfs source code on Github</subtitle>
<id>http://nuetzlich.net/cgit/gocryptfs/atom?h=xattr_user_buffer</id>
<link rel='self' href='http://nuetzlich.net/cgit/gocryptfs/atom?h=xattr_user_buffer'/>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/'/>
<updated>2022-01-03T14:18:59+00:00</updated>
<entry>
<title>readpassword: bubble up errors instead of exiting the process</title>
<updated>2022-01-03T14:18:59+00:00</updated>
<author>
<name>Jakob Unterwurzacher</name>
</author>
<published>2022-01-03T14:18:59+00:00</published>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/commit/?id=4b251f3ce1f0a0472ed10a00aeef70c69ba03a5d'/>
<id>urn:sha1:4b251f3ce1f0a0472ed10a00aeef70c69ba03a5d</id>
<content type='text'>
This allows cleanups to happen in the caller, like removing
the control socket.

Fixes https://github.com/rfjakob/gocryptfs/issues/634
</content>
</entry>
<entry>
<title>main: accept multiple -passfile options</title>
<updated>2020-05-17T17:31:04+00:00</updated>
<author>
<name>Jakob Unterwurzacher</name>
</author>
<published>2020-05-17T17:31:04+00:00</published>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/commit/?id=416080203b4dd79de857eaf7c7cc97d050e00a9f'/>
<id>urn:sha1:416080203b4dd79de857eaf7c7cc97d050e00a9f</id>
<content type='text'>
Each file will be read and then concatenated
for the effictive password. This can be used as a
kind of multi-factor authenticiton.

Fixes https://github.com/rfjakob/gocryptfs/issues/288
</content>
</entry>
<entry>
<title>Allow multiple -extpass arguments</title>
<updated>2019-03-03T12:25:30+00:00</updated>
<author>
<name>Jakob Unterwurzacher</name>
</author>
<published>2019-03-03T12:25:30+00:00</published>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/commit/?id=cf27037f20723e934320edeff7f8aa356bdca467'/>
<id>urn:sha1:cf27037f20723e934320edeff7f8aa356bdca467</id>
<content type='text'>
To support arguments containing spaces, -extpass can now
be passed multiple times.

https://github.com/rfjakob/gocryptfs/issues/289
</content>
</entry>
<entry>
<title>tests: fix TestPassfileNewline</title>
<updated>2018-12-16T11:33:25+00:00</updated>
<author>
<name>Jakob Unterwurzacher</name>
</author>
<published>2018-12-16T11:33:25+00:00</published>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/commit/?id=a55e53c196be73fbf06cef00c50f10752aaf1275'/>
<id>urn:sha1:a55e53c196be73fbf06cef00c50f10752aaf1275</id>
<content type='text'>
Due to a copy-paste error, we ran the wrong test in the
subprocess.

Thanks @slackner for noticing at
https://github.com/rfjakob/gocryptfs/commit/295d432175292dbaef572093d784aab55f5c0b8f#r31690478 !
</content>
</entry>
<entry>
<title>passfile: directly read file instead of invoking cat</title>
<updated>2018-12-15T16:09:38+00:00</updated>
<author>
<name>Jakob Unterwurzacher</name>
</author>
<published>2018-12-15T16:09:38+00:00</published>
<link rel='alternate' type='text/html' href='http://nuetzlich.net/cgit/gocryptfs/commit/?id=295d432175292dbaef572093d784aab55f5c0b8f'/>
<id>urn:sha1:295d432175292dbaef572093d784aab55f5c0b8f</id>
<content type='text'>
Allows better error handling, gets rid of the call to an
external program, and fixes https://github.com/rfjakob/gocryptfs/issues/278 .
</content>
</entry>
</feed>
